Hey Batting Batting Batting!

On March 21, 2018March 19, 2018 By MalloryIn Fabric, Notions and tools, Projects, TechniquesLeave a comment

Batting is like the middle child of a quilt sandwich - outshined by the top and hidden by the backing, usually forgotten. But batting is a very important part of the quilt! It is what gives the quilt structure and warm. It is quite literally the heart of the quilt. There are many types of …
